During an official working visit to the UAE,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an hosted President Félix Tshisekedi of the Democratic Republic of the Congo. Their discussion centered on fortifying bilateral relations and augmenting cooperation in crucial sectors.
Both leaders considered avenues to enhance their economic and development collaborations, specifically referencing the Comprehensive Economic Partnership Agreement (CEPA). They explored ways to align these initiatives with respective national development goals, aiming for shared growth and prosperity.
Beyond economic matters, the dialogue included the evolving situation in the Middle East and its implications for security both regionally and globally. President Tshisekedi condemned the violence aimed at civilians and infrastructure, asserting that such actions disrupt peace and violate international treaties.
He reiterated the Democratic Republic of the Congo’s unwavering support for the UAE, backing its endeavors to uphold national security, protect sovereignty, and ensure citizen safety.
The meeting saw the presence of high-ranking UAE officials, including Sheikh Hamdan bin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Sheikh Nahyan bin Mubarak Al Nahyan, Sheikh Mohammed bin Hamad bin Tahnoun Al Nahyan, and Sheikh Shakhboot bin Nahyan Al Nahyan, along with various ministers and officials.
Upon his arrival in the UAE, President Tshisekedi was warmly received by Sheikh Shakhboot bin Nahyan Al Nahyan, marking the initiation of this official visit aimed at strengthening diplomatic and economic connections between their nations.
